DUBAI, UAE : McDonald’s UAE has unveiled updates to its customer ordering experience with the addition of the ‘Order Ahead’ Service. Using the McDonald’s App, customers can now order their meals and pay in advance for pick up at front counters and Drive-Thru across the country at their convenience. Those who wish to enjoy dine-in can also use the service to skip the queues and have their orders delivered to their tables.

The customer experience is at the heart of our offering and the new service ensures a customized ordering that best suits everyone’s needs. The development also aligns with growing customer demand for convenient solutions to the end-to-end experience, as well as the increasing role of mobile devices in the purchasing process.

Orders will be ready at the counters for those who choose to pick up from the restaurant, or can be delivered directly to customers who choose table service. Those who wish to pick up their order at one of the Drive-Thru service many locations can do so conveniently by ordering and paying in advance. The process is also integrated with the Rewards Program, allowing customers to earn and redeem reward points.

Walid Fakih, General Manager at McDonald's UAE, commented, "We strive to create memorable moments for our customers and we achieve this through continuous innovation and personalization. The launch of the Order Ahead Service exclusively on the McDonald’s App allows us to further enhance our customer experience and provide another layer of functionality to our mobile application users. We want to elevate the comfort factor offered to our customers, by inviting them to order and receive their meals at their convenience, and we will continue to innovate and create tailored offers with seamless experiences so everyone can enjoy the feel-good experience that is synonymous with our brand."

The Order Ahead Service is now live and is available on the McDonald’s App.

About McDonald’s UAE:

Operating since 1994, McDonald's UAE today has more than 180 restaurants geographically located to service customers in many areas. McDonald’s UAE is committed to the quality of the products it serves at each restaurant and also maintains an active social responsibility agenda.

In an ongoing effort to contribute to the wellbeing of the communities and highlight the continuous environmental benefits of their actions McDonald’s UAE and Emirates Environmental Group joined forces in spreading green values among the UAE’s children by planting trees across the nation as part of their ‘Planting a Greener Future’ campaign. McDonald’s UAE also significantly reduced its carbon footprint since the launch of its biodiesel initiative in July 2011. 100% of McDonald’s used vegetable oil is collected from its restaurants across the UAE and converted into 100% biodiesel which is used to fuel the company’s logistics fleet.

In addition, McDonald’s UAE prides itself on being a local member of the community and has been committed to being a responsible corporate citizen since the first restaurant opened in the UAE back in 1994.
